Ticket: Sandbox user-supplied formulas in Gristmark

Reviewer: this change wraps user formulas in the Quillbox sandbox — no filesystem, no network, 100 ms CPU cap per evaluation. Escapes now raise a typed error instead of failing silently. Tests cover recursion bombs and oversized outputs. Merge is blocked pending sign-off from the owner named below.

named custodian: Rusion Joreth Holvan Norwyn

Subject: Drossel Pilot — Exec Update

Team,

Quick status on the pilot with the Drossel retail chain. Eight stores live. Conversion up 3%, returns flat. Their merchandising head is satisfied; legal is reviewing the expansion rider. We need pricing locked by Friday. Sales leads: do not discuss rollout scope with their regional managers yet. Escalate any press inquiries to me directly. Rationale for the timing is in the confidential note below.

board note of hawip-tajof: Project Eliix slips by one quarter because of the supplier delay.

**Vendor note: Inkmill markdown pipeline**

Rendering for Parchway docs is outsourced to Inkmill under an annual contract, renewing each March. They handle sanitization and PDF export; we own the upload queue. SLA: 4-hour response on rendering failures. Escalate only after two failed retries. Their support desk is reachable at the address below.

billing contact of hahaf-baguf = zorael.tammir.jorius@sivrelhq.internal

# Pilot Churn — Managers Only

Quick orientation for the incoming director. The Lanthorn Pilot kicked off with 42 customers; we've lost 11 so far, mostly small accounts citing onboarding friction rather than price. The good news: the remaining cohort shows strong weekly usage of the Keelway dashboard, and two accounts upgraded voluntarily. We're trimming the setup flow and adding a guided-start option next sprint. How this feeds into the bigger picture is noted confidentially below.

confidential, yahip-hagug: Gorixax Logistics plans to lower the Ulaael list price by 26.6 percent in October. The pricing group signed off on a budget of $199.9 million for Project Holix. The renewal with Kasdorox Systems closes at $137.5 million a year, 8.2 percent above the last contract. Project Lamion slips by a full year because of the audit delay.